Transaction 143a76147471480302389d5a09f9e1dc5a45cb6c467f8d91ea6001752e2bc33c

1 Input
2 Outputs
  • 143a76147471480302389d5a09f9e1dc5a45cb6c467f8d91ea6001752e2bc33c:0
  • value  2088491
    address  3CNhNGYdh1cNQKiRev3519n9xfN1avYuwH
  • 143a76147471480302389d5a09f9e1dc5a45cb6c467f8d91ea6001752e2bc33c:1
  • value  77321250
    address  1LdnhdCPWmJxdsMGMJJUCABzWNqeSi6s4g